Recall is the reinstatement of a laid off employee to active status within the period as defined in the provision on seniority.
In a recall situation, employees who were previously laid off return to their employer. Often, but not always, these employees return to the same role that they left. An employee recall usually means that your business' situation has improved enough to bring back one or more employees.
Recall rights are in effect for one to three years from the date of layoff depending on years of service and in accordance with applicable collective bargaining agreement. Recall rights terminate for the reasons such as, if an employee: Refuses to be recalled.

Employees who are laid off will be maintained on a recall list for six months or until management determines the layoff is permanent, whichever occurs first. Removal from the recall list terminates all job rights the employee may have.
You can and should use your PPP funds to rehire or recall workers. Under the terms of the PPP Flexibility Act, you had until December 31, 2020, to bring back all of the workers you laid off or furloughed in order to be eligible for full forgiveness.
